Terra Cotta Pizzeria Windsor’s First Wood-Burning Pizza, Est. 1992 “Built on tradition. Powered by passion. Every pizza tells our story — a story of craftsmanship, community, and unwavering quality. As we grow into tomorrow, we honour the fire that started it all.”

Warm, relaxed Italian venue offering wood-burning, thin-crust pizza plus salads, wraps & sandwiches.

Gee R
Leaving a one star after my only two experiences here that were both just strange.

1. Came on a Tuesday and was charged a 2$ service charge because on 2 for 1 Tuesdays you need to order a drink. Had I know that, I would have ordered one. But again the server never informed.

2. Came again and there was all kinds of strangeness. First, I was charged a dollar for a box because I asked for the second pizza to go, however my friend wasn’t charged for his box because he didn’t ASK for his to go, but took it to go….

Next, she told us to each pay half of the total bill amount even though we ordered different pizzas at different price points saying that they don’t split bills on Tuesdays…

Anyway, when I spoke to the waitress about not being told about the box charge or the other issues she tried to bring my friend into the convo saying that he should know about it, she then said “this is what the tell us to do”.. when I simply said that whether they upcharge or add service charges for non-ordering of drinks etc they just NEED to inform the guest she just stared at me and asked if I wanted my dollar.

Zero customer service. Zero transparency. Zero accountability.

Oh and when she asked if I wanted a copy of my reciept and I replied no, she said okay I’ll just burn it???

Avoid this place if you can because 2 for 1 pizza isn’t worth it when you have to deal with this.

Craig Lockhart
Terra Cotta Pizza – A family review

(Our quest to find the best pizza place in Windsor)

Review #8 (See Sarducci’s East for review #7)

$54 for 4 individual pizzas (6 slices each).

Terra Cotta is a nice little spot. You can dine in or take out. It would be a great place to sit in the summer as there is a patio out front. Sitting inside on a Winter Day would be nice too. It’s a cozy spot that reminds me of New York or Chicago.

Daughter – 7 – Neutral

Son 17 – Harsh critic

Pre taste – 6/10
Cheese – 8
Sauce – 4
Crust – Rarely eats it
Overall – 6

Wife – Relaxed critic

Pre taste – 6
Cheese – 8
Sauce – 6
Crust – 6
Overall – 7

Dad – Neutral critic

Pre taste – 7 – The look reminded me of little Caesars pizza a bit, except a lot thinner.

Cheese – 6 – It was pretty hard to taste the cheese and sauce at times because the pizza is extremely thin. There’s not much to it

Sauce – 6 – Same as cheese, the pizza is pretty salty. It definitely takes away from the quality of the pizza.

Crust – 7 – Crust was pretty good. Nice and crunchy. A lot of it though. Definitely not for you if you’re not a fan of crust.

Overall – 6 – I really wanted to love this pizza. The restaurant has charm and the staff are very friendly. Unfortunately the pizza is more like frozen pizza you can buy from the grocery store. It’s very pricey for the quantity and quality offered. As I said, the pizza was very salty. It really is a last moment option. Or because they serve alcohol, having a slice with a beer. I would not recommend Terra Cotta to anyone who’s never had it before.

Final family score – 63%
